Anyone use this to add options to there 2019 yet, or have any issues getting it to communicate with there truck since I can't find any info if it will work on the 2019 to add options since its different from the 4th gens?

I'm trying to figure out what I'm going to do to turn on the aux switches in my truck other than the dealer since the 19's have 6 aux buttons and the 4th gens had 5.
 
you will need the bypass from infotainment the module its in the back of the cluster.

But if you have the aux switches from factory installed is in the commercial menu in the cluster.
 
you'll need the security bypass cable. search google, you can get it from several spots.
